Sustainable urban development seeks to fulfil current community requirements without sacrificing the capacity of future generations. It seeks to balance the rise of the human population with environmental sustainability. To support economic, environmental, and social sustainability, it incorporates green building designs, sustainable architecture, and carbon footprint reductions. Cities may become more adaptable to climate change via planned sustainable urban design, ensuring they stay habitable while encouraging economic, social, and environmental balance. Sustainable Urban Design Principles 

The Sustainable Urban Design Principles focus on developing habitats that are efficient, resilient, and beneficial to both the earth and its inhabitants. The key concepts include:

Green Technology Integration: Using solar panels, wind turbines, and novel water recycling ways to power cities sustainably.

  • Green Space Promotion: Creating roof gardens, community gardens, and parks to improve both well-being and the environment.
  • Adoption of sustainable architecture: Emphasizing energy efficiency, resource conservation, and the incorporation of smart technology to create buildings and environments that are both practical and ecologically benign.
  • Sustainable Mobility Principles: Create walkable communities to decrease vehicle use and promote public transportation and community growth. Prioritize bicycle networks by creating safe cycling environments and parking spaces to support cycling as a key method of travel. Develop dense networks of roadways and trails to optimize traffic flow and increase pedestrian safety.
  • Economic and Social Considerations: Zone mixed-use areas to retain a feeling of place and efficiency.Match density with transit capacity to ensure housing is convenient to public transportation and jobs. Encourage social equality and public engagement in planning procedures to meet varied community demands.

Mixed-use projects and compact city designs

Mixed-use projects and compact city designs stand out in terms of sustainable urban development due to their numerous benefits. These layouts promote the integration of residential, commercial, and recreational areas in close proximity, resulting in dynamic, walkable communities. Let’s take a deeper look at the benefits.

  • Economic and social benefits: Mixed-use projects help local economies by lowering individual transit costs and encouraging local companies, which contributes to increased municipal revenue through real estate taxes. They also encourage social connections and community cohesiveness, making cities more welcoming and dynamic places to live. 
  • Effect on the environment: These advancements greatly reduce air pollution and carbon emissions by decreasing the use of personal automobiles. They also assist in the integration of green spaces and the implementation of sustainable practices such as renewable energy sources and trash reduction initiatives, so contributing to the overall sustainability of urban areas

Support for Sustainable Urban Living: Compact, mixed-use complexes correlate with ‘Smart City’ programs, which employ technology to improve urban efficiency and livability. They provide a variety of housing possibilities, attract a diverse audience, and revitalize neglected locations, eventually promoting non-vehicular access to resources and amenities, which is critical for long-term urban growth.

Archi-Tectonics NYC and! Melk were named the champions of a 2018 competition to create a masterplan change for the Hangzhou Asian Games Park 2022. The now-completed project spans 116 acres and includes an immense Eco Park and seven structures. Although its original goal was to serve as a site for the Hangzhou Asian Games 2022, the team’s ambition went well beyond that, paving a new route for the city’s environmental future. Using a “Sponge-City” landscape technique, the project created a hilly sanctuary for year-round recreational usage. In practice, the oasis serves as a green lung, renewing the surrounding ecology.

Integrating smart technology into urban design

Integrating smart technology into urban design is critical for improving the sustainability and living conditions of communities. Key applications include:

  • Smart energy systems integrate renewable energy sources, such solar and wind power, to reduce carbon emissions while effectively controlling energy usage through the use of IoT and AI.
  • Intelligent Transit Systems (ITS) maximize efficiency in public transportation by optimizing routes and reducing congestion through real-time data processing.
  • Adaptive Urban Infrastructure: Artificial learning and Internet of things technology allow for dynamic modifications in the lighting of streets and traffic management, dramatically decreasing energy usage and urban carbon footprints.

In addition to promoting efficient and adaptive urban life, these technologies help improve governance and service delivery, which boosts economic growth. The combination of sustainable urban design concepts with smart technology maximizes the benefits of both, giving critical timely information for accurate decision-making and policy formation. Cities may improve waste management by implementing innovative composting and recycling facilities that use machine learning, converting rubbish into profitable assets and contributing to long-term sustainability.
